Shuvee Etrata clarifies old posts about Vice Ganda, denies malicious intent

Old video sparks backlash

Social media personality Shuvee Etrata faced backlash after netizens resurfaced an old video where she reacted “eww” to Vice Ganda.

Another meme she previously shared, involving Vice Ganda and Coco Martin, also circulated online, tied to controversies surrounding ABS-CBN’s franchise shutdown.

Etrata explains comments

Etrata clarified her “eww” reaction meant they were both girls, stressing she never intended disrespect or insult toward Vice Ganda.

She emphasized memes featuring Vice were purely humorous, denying harboring ill feelings, and reaffirming admiration for the comedian’s longstanding entertainment industry career.

Denies support for shutdown

Addressing allegations about ABS-CBN, Etrata insisted she opposed the shutdown, citing earlier tweets describing the network as cultural and institutionally significant.

She refuted accusations of celebrating the closure, arguing critics deliberately misrepresented her past posts to malign her reputation unfairly online.

Steps taken after backlash

Etrata temporarily deactivated her X account, prioritizing mental health, as overwhelming negativity followed circulation of those resurfaced materials.

She confirmed reaching out to Vice Ganda, hoping for direct communication to clarify context personally and repair unnecessary damage caused.

Admits regrets, promises growth

Etrata admitted regretting youthful online behavior, saying she learned accountability, and now carefully considers jokes, memes, and public statements shared.

She expressed desire for people to judge her current self, not mistakes from adolescence, highlighting growth and commitment toward mindfulness.

Public reacts differently

Supporters sympathized with Etrata, saying everyone deserves second chances, while critics demanded stronger accountability despite her current efforts for redemption.

The controversy sparked larger conversations on cancel culture, accountability, and how old social media posts permanently affect public figures today.

Moving forward

Etrata vowed to improve continuously, stating she would embrace criticism constructively, prove maturity, and create respectful, responsible online content consistently.

Despite ongoing controversy, she remains hopeful reconciliation with Vice Ganda will restore goodwill and allow career opportunities without unnecessary baggage.
